> Harald Braumann wrote:
> 
>> Would it be possible, to provide a minimal hal package that _only_ provides
>> information about hardware and hotplugging events? All the additional stuff
>> could be provided in an add-on package, which hal would recommend. I think,
>> this could be useful also for others who don't use the GNOME or KDE OS.
> 
> Hi Harry,
> 
> I agree with you, that HAL has somewhat grown into a kitchensync over its
> lifetime. Unfortunately it's not easily, if at all possible to rip HAL apart 
> in
> smaller pieces (that's why I mark the bug as wontfix).
> 
> On the other hand, there is work underway to replace HAL with something new,
> more modular, called DeviceKit, where you have separate components (e.g.
> DeviceKit-power, DeviceKit-disks), which can be installed separately and will
> deprecate/replace HAL step by step.
